Best National Parks Near Mio, MI

Bruce Peninsula National Park, located on the tip of the Bruce Peninsula in Ontario, Canada, is about a three-hour drive from Mio. The park has several campgrounds, including one that's open year-round. If you plan to visit Bruce Peninsula National Park during your RV vacation, remember to bring your passport. The park is known for its stunning natural beauty, including the rugged coastline of Georgian Bay and the Niagara Escarpment. Visitors to Bruce Peninsula National Park can enjoy a range of outdoor activities, including hiking, camping, and swimming in the clear waters of Georgian Bay. The park is home to a variety of wildlife, including black bears, coyotes, and bald eagles, as well as numerous species of plants and trees. One of the park's most popular attractions is the Grotto, a stunning sea cave that can be accessed by swimming or hiking. The park also offers guided tours of the Fathom Five National Marine Park, which is home to several shipwrecks and a variety of marine life.

Popular State Parks Near Mio, MI

Hartwick Pines State Park is a popular destination for campers near Mio, Michigan. Be sure to spend some time exploring the property’s scenic beauty and learn more about its history with a visit to the Hartwick Pines Nature Center. It features a large area of woodlands with many trails for hiking, mountain biking, and snowmobiling. Visitors can enjoy hiking through the lush forest, viewing wildlife, and learning about the history of Michigan's logging industry at the park's museum. With more than 1,600 acres of land, North Higgins Lake State Park is one of the most popular parks in Michigan. The park’s beaches are ideal for swimming and sunbathing. It also has a marina and rental cabins available for visitors. The park offers plenty of opportunity for fishing and boating, along with a variety of other activities. The park's sandy beach and crystal-clear water make it a perfect spot for family outings.

National Forests Near Mio, MI

The Huron-Manistee National Forest and the Hiawatha National Forest are both located in the northern part of Michigan. Huron-Manistee National Forest covers over 978,000 acres of land and is divided into two separate units, the Huron National Forest and the Manistee National Forest. Visitors can enjoy a variety of outdoor activities, including hiking, fishing, hunting, and camping. The forest is home to several scenic rivers, including the Au Sable and Manistee Rivers, which provide excellent opportunities for fishing and kayaking. Hiawatha National Forest, on the other hand, covers over 880,000 acres of land and is located in the eastern part of the Upper Peninsula of Michigan. The forest offers visitors a chance to explore rugged terrain, including a 21-mile stretch of Lake Superior shoreline, pristine rivers, and numerous waterfalls. The forest is also home to a variety of wildlife, including black bears, moose, and bald eagles, making it an ideal destination for wildlife enthusiasts.

Must-see Monuments and Landmarks Near Mio, MI

Perry's Victory and International Peace Memorial and Father Marquette National Memorial are two historical locations in the United States that honour significant occasions in the history of the nation. Father Jacques Marquette, a French Jesuit missionary who was instrumental in the exploration of the Great Lakes region in the 17th century, is remembered at the Father Marquette National Memorial in Michigan. Father Marquette is commemorated by a statue at the memorial, which also houses a museum detailing his life and accomplishments. Ohio's Perry's Victory and International Peace Memorial honours the Battle of Lake Erie, a significant naval action in the War of 1812, and is situated there. A 352-foot-tall tower at the memorial provides breathtaking views of Lake Erie and the adjacent surroundings. Visitors can also learn about the history of the battle and its significance in promoting peace and friendship between the United States, Canada, and Great Britain.

How do I properly navigate and park a Class C motorhome rental in urban areas or tight spaces in Mio, MI?

When navigating and parking a Class C motorhome rental in urban areas or tight spaces, it's important to take your time and plan your route beforehand. Familiarize yourself with the dimensions of the motorhome and the height and width restrictions of the roads you'll be traveling on. When it comes to parking, look for designated spots or parking garages that can accommodate the size of your RV. Always pay attention to signage and be aware of any towing restrictions in the area.

Do I need to know any weight or height restrictions when driving a Class C motorhome rental in Mio, MI?

Yes, it's important to be aware of weight and height restrictions when driving a Class C motorhome rental in Mio, MI. Many bridges and overpasses have low clearance levels that may not accommodate the height of your RV. Additionally, be mindful of the weight of your vehicle and ensure that you're not exceeding any weight limits on the roads you're traveling.

What fuel efficiency considerations do I need to consider when driving a Class C motorhome rental, and how can I minimize the impact on my fuel costs?

Class C motorhome rentals are generally less fuel-efficient than smaller vehicles, so it's important to be mindful of your fuel usage. To minimize fuel costs, try to stick to slower speeds and avoid idling or rapid acceleration. Planning out your route ahead of time can also help you save fuel by avoiding unnecessary detours or backtracking.
